Function description
Field of application
The FPS16 Fresh powder system is built exclusively for electrostatic coat-
ing with organic powders. Any other use is not considered as intended
use. The manufacturer is not responsible for any incorrect use and the
risks associated with such actions are assumed by the user alone.
Overview
The Fresh powder system is suited for supplying the powder coating
equipment with powder from large containers (Big Bag). The powder sup-
ply takes place continuously from the large container and in accordance
to the consumption in the coating plant. The powder transport is automat-
ically switched on and off by messages from the level sensor in the pow-
der container. The powder is aspirated in pulses by a vacuum, and sub-
sequently transported with conveying air.
Versions
The FPS16 Fresh powder system is available either with one or with two
powder pumps (FPS16-2). The FPS16-2 version permits a powder
transport from the large powder container to two different destinations.
FPS16-1 FPS16-2

Technical Data
FPS16 Fresh powder system
Conveying performance
FPS16
Conveying performance
3500-5000 g/min for each pump*
(according to the material to be
conveyed, suction and conveying
length, powder preparation etc.)
Conveying line
up to 8 m (5 kg/min conveying per-
formance)
8-16 m (4 kg/min conveying per-
formance)
16-25 m (3.5 kg/min conveying per-
formance)
Hose diameter Transport side
NW 16 mm
Suction line
up to 5 m
Material to be conveyed
Coating powder
Remaining quantity
< 5% of the original container con-
tent*
*The indicated values are guide values; possible deviations are depend-
ent on the powder type and the large container (BigBag) geometry!
Electrical data
FPS16
Power supply
3x400 VAC
24 VDC
Frequency
50/60 Hz

Pneumatic data
FPS16
Compressed air
5-8 bar / 101-145 psi
Air consumption
max. 0.5 Nm³/h for lifting procedure
max. 12 Nm³/h for each PP0x
Powder pump
max. 0.5 Nm³/h for fluidization
Max. water vapor content
1.3 g/m³
Max. oil vapor content
0.1 mg/m³
Dimensions
FPS16
Weight
approx. 340 kg
Max. load
500 kg
Container base area
max. 800 x 1000 mm
Container height incl. loops
1160/1260/1360 mm
Container specifications (big bag)
FPS16
Suspension system
4-point loops
Version
square, no partition walls, with
emptying funnel
Safety factor
min. 5:1 for disposable use
min. 8:1 for reuse
Material incl. suspension loops
conductive, R<108ohm

Support
The fresh powder system support is formed by three wall elements and
the crossbeam for the lifting devices. The wall elements must be installed
on the floor, so that the stability under load can be ensured. The cross-
beam can be installed, depending on the container, on three different
heights.
Lifting device for large containers
The lifting device for large containers consists of the hang up plate and
two pneumatic cylinders. The operation and the control takes place by the
attached control cabinet.
Fluidizing/suction tube
The fluidizing/suction tube enables the loosening of the powder in the
container, and aspirates the powder for the powder pump.
Lifting device for fluidizing/suction tube
The fluidizing/suction tube can be lifted manually by a cable and can be
fixed in this position by hooking-in the final loop. The fluidizing/suction
tube is lifted only during the change of the large container.
Vibrating plate
When using the vibrating plate, the constant powder transport is guaran-
teed. The vibrating plate is hung on the hang-up plate by means of two
spring hooks and is then laid loosely onto the Big Bag. The vibrating op-
eration is started automatically every time the suction is switched on.
However, the vibration can be manually switched on and off using an ad-
ditional switch, and a light indicates the condition.
Control
All operation and control elements for the Fresh powder system are im-
plemented in the laterally attached control unit.
Powder pump
The laterally attached powder pump aspirates the powder, if required, by
the fluidizing/suction tube and ensures the transport to the powder con-
tainer in the coating plant. Please observe the operating manual of the
corresponding powder pump!

Function
In the starting position of the Fresh powder system, the fluidizing/suction
tube is lifted up and the lifting cylinders for the large container are low-
ered.
The large powder container is now put into the support by a pallet lifting
truck. All four lifting loops are hung up to the bolts; an unintentional hang-
out will be prevented by the existing rubber straps. The large powder con-
tainer is opened now, and the fluidizing/suction tube is slowly lowered into
the powder. Now press the Conveying ready key on the control unit and
the powder transport will be switched on, according to requirement. The
lifting procedure of the container is now also automatically switched on by
reaching the max. lifting weight (adjustable depending on cylinder pres-
sure).
Powder flow detection
The powder transport is monitored by the powder flow detection during
the conveying procedure. If during a powder requirement by the level
sensor no or too little powder flows through the conveying line within a de-
fined time, this will be recognized by the installed sensor. This powder
shortage actuates an up/down procedure of the powder container (Big
Bag). This procedure is automatically interrupted when the Powder
shortage signal is reset, and otherwise constantly repeated during an ad-
justable time. If the powder shortage will not be reset by the up/down pro-
cedure during a defined time, an alarm message for the operating per-
sonnel will be released.

Operating and display elements
Control cabinet
The control cabinet contains the following operating elements:
Fig.
2
: Control cabinet view
Pos.
Function
Description
1
Main switch
The complete control unit is disconnected from the mains with the
main switch
2
Conveying ready
The powder transport readiness takes place by pressing the Con-
veying ready key
The readiness is indicated by the indicator lamp (pos. 6)
Therewith, the lifting up of the large container will be started. De-
pending on the weight in the large container, the lifting up takes
place after the powder discharge, if the weight of the container is
smaller than the adjusted lifting power of the pneumatic cylinders
As soon as the level sensor of the powder container detects “emp-
ty”, the powder transport and the vibrating plate switch on automati-
cally
3
Cleaning
By pressing the Cleaning key, the rinsing procedure of the powder
pump will be started. The suction unit must be lifted manually and
can be blown off with compressed air and can be cleaned (Attention
–large dust formation possible!)
4
Conveying off
By pressing the Conveying off key, the powder conveying proce-
dure will be interrupted and the large powder container lowers im-
mediately.
5
Big Bag empty
This red indicator lamp illuminates, if the powder flow sensor does
not detect powder during a defined time. Now the large powder con-
tainer must be checked by the operating personnel and probably be
changed

Start-up
Electrical allocation
ATTENTION:
The equipment and the vibrating plate are necessarily to be ground-
ed with the ground connection!
►As ground conductor, use a copper cable with a cross-section of at
least 4 mm²!
Main module inputs
Entry
Description
I1
External interlocking/Automatic operating mode must
be operated with switch –control unit is ready for op-
eration. Powder box will be lifted
I2
External fresh powder requirement (pump 1)
I3
External fresh powder requirement (pump 2)
I4
Activate cleaning mode
I5
Reserve
I6
Reserve
I7
Analog input 0-10 V / pressure sensor for pump 1
I8
Analog input 0-10 V / pressure sensor for pump 2
Main module outputs
Output
Description
Q1
main solenoid valves
Q2
Solenoid valve –lift cylinder
Q3
Warning lamp - no powder
Q4
Potential-free contact –no powder (max. voltage 230
VAC)

V 07/21
18 •Start-up FPS16
Additional module inputs
Entry
Description
I1-I4
Reserve
Additional module outputs
Output
Description
Q1
Conveying on - pump 1
Q2
Conveying on - pump 2
Q3
Pinch valve –preventing excess air suction of pump 1
Q4
Pinch valve –preventing excess air suction of pump 2
Pneumatic connection
The compressed air must be connected to the control unit input in ac-
cordance to the specifications. All compressed air consumers will be sup-
plied by the control unit.
Description
1
Lift/lower
2
Fluidizing air
P min = 0.5 bar
3
Compressed air supply, pinch valves (FPS16-2 version only)
P max. = 3.0 bar
